Structural Drying Process
The structural drying process involves using specialized equipment to dry the affected areas of your home.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and air movers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. Water Extraction Service: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ained messes.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Call a pro for large, complex water damage situations.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| Maybe | Maybe | DIY might be okay for small areas, but call a pro for larger messes. |

How do I prevent water damage in the future?
To prevent water damage in the future, make sure to inspect your home regularly for signs of leaks and water damage. Check your roof, gutters, and downspouts for damage, and consider installing a sump pump or backup power source in case of a power outage.
